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
01507367209 1830 458781
7878314479 386 7175
7878314479 386 7175
677240895 228 49556 9643
All about undefined
Interested in learning more?
7878314479 386 7175
677240895 228 49556 9643
See more
746771666 649203165 105727
244502987 654046 4712667
See more
23650 82290
146729 6776 33
See more